Algae and their properties
Seaweeds (海藻, kaisō) have been an important part of the Japanese diet for many centuries. These are the main ones with their properties and some are certainly also found in Europe: Nori; Kombu; Wakame; Mekabu; Hijiki; Kanten. NORI: contains a balanced presence of vitamins (vitamins A, C and B), mineral salts and Omega 3. Why is a sports massage important for performance?
Whether you’re an athlete, a once-a-week jogger or just physically active, a sports massage helps drain away fatigue, reduce muscle tension, promote flexibility and overall prepare you for peak performance. It can also help prevent those trivial injuries that get in the way of your performance.

Nutrition challenges of the female athlete
When it comes to endurance events, the differences in performance between men and women becomes smaller and smaller, the longer the event. In the last few years we have women in endurance competitions, that are at least as fast as the men’s! It is often hypothesised that this is because of differences in metabolism between men and women. Vegan diet and sport, is it possible?
There are no particular contraindications in consuming mainly plant-based foods It is however important that the diet includes the consumption of a large class of food of plant origin (dried fruit, vegetables, legumes, etc.).
